Job Summary



This is a R&D Technical Lead (DevOps) role reporting to the R&D Product Manager in the Business Area - Process Automation, located in Bangalore, India. You will be contributing with own ideas to identifying, proposing and implementing innovative technology development and solutions.

Your responsibilities

  • Providing broad technical software support, training, pilots and consulting services for clients and to carry out the implementation of company software product in pulp and paper industry, working on digital project implementation in pulp and paper industry.
  • Analyzing and gathering customer requirements and proposing appropriate solutions for pulp and paper projects, working with Project Managers to define scope, features and estimates for new projects, planning project activities with local and remote teams.
  • Working directly on development tasks, providing technical leadership, coordinating with other resources and creating high quality products within the defined schedules and budgets, working with customers to define new opportunities for plant level applications.
  • Being proficient or having the capability of becoming proficient at installing, configuring, developing a work-flow process, troubleshooting the software, and staying current with upgrades, updates and patches. Planning and making technological training for customer key users or internal team. Preparing clear & concise documents.
  • Apart from project responsibility, also providing strategic sales, training, and customer/application support.
  • Living ABB s core values of safety and integrity, which means taking responsibility for your own actions while caring for your colleagues and the business.

Your background

  • Must have a bachelor s degree B.E / B.Tech / MCA with 60% and above.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ience in windows application design and development using .NET framework, .Net, Core, C#, WPF & WCF (overall experience to be 8+).
  • Working with Pulp & paper industry applications & knowledge of any DCS/PLC/SCADA applications will be an added advantage. Experience of relational database Oracle / SQL Server/ PostgreSQL, time series database.Deep knowledge of object-oriented programming, Design Principles and Design patterns.
  • Should have excellent troubleshooting skills at module, product & system levels using any of the tools like DebugDiag, WinDbg (system internal tools). Knowledge on Digital Signatures (binaries and Exe), expertise in setting up CI/CD pipeline from scratch in Azure DevOps/TFS, set the branch/merge strategy as required by the project, creation of build and version control of the same, creation of packages for a release, deployment of the builds/packages in Cloud environment, integration of static code analysis, test frameworks as part of the pipeline and expertise in InstallShield for packaging.
  • Must be well organized able to work independently or as part of a team constructively with minimal supervision, robust to work within a high-pressure automotive environment with a positive, proactive attitude. An engaging mind, open to new problems outside your normal comfort zone and willing to engage in debate and discussion.
